'Can not upload the file' error when attaching from Dropbox to Gmail on Android
When I try to add an attachment from dropbox to a mail in gmail, I receive a message in gmail "can not upload the file". This error occurs only on one smartphone with android 12. If I do the same , w...

Hi Everybody,
I've spoken with our Engineering team about this, who have confirmed that the 'Attach from Dropbox' option no longer being available is the result of an update to the Android OS and Gmail app, specifically Storage Access Framework. This means that the option to Attach from Dropbox will no longer be available.
As others have stated, to attach files, you will need to select Attach File in Gmail, open the hamburger menu on the left, select Dropbox, then choose the files to be uploaded.

I using the Gmail app on my Pixel 6A phone. I hit the little paper clip in the email and go to the drop box option, search for a folder and then find the file and click on it. The file briefly shows up underneath the body of the text in the Gmail app and then says "cannot attach file". I can go to the Dropbox folder and share to the Gmail app. However, I cannot keep the same thread in the Gmail going because I cannot attach files from Dropbox when needed. I hope this helps.
